Truffle Cherries Recipe
  • Prep: 20 min. + chilling
  • Yield: 24 Servings

Ingredients

  • 1/3 cup heavy whipping cream
  • 2 tablespoons butter
  • 2 tablespoons sugar
  • 4 ounces semisweet chocolate, chopped
  • 1 jar (8 ounces) maraschino cherries with stems, well drained
  • COATING:
  • 6 ounces semisweet chocolate, chopped
  • 2 tablespoons shortening

Directions

  • In a small saucepan, bring the cream, butter and sugar to a boil; stirring constantly. Remove from the heat; stir in chocolate until melted. Cover and refrigerate for at least 4 hours or until easy to handle.
  • Pat cherries with paper towels until very dry. Shape a teaspoonful of chocolate mixture around each cherry, forming a ball. Cover and refrigerate for 2-3 hours or until firm.
  • In a microwave, melt chocolate and shortening; stir until smooth. Dip cherries until coated; all excess to drip off. Place on waxed paper to set. Yield: about 2 dozen.

Nutritional Facts 1 serving (1 each) equals 57 calories, 4 g fat (2 g saturated fat), 7 mg cholesterol, 11 mg sodium, 6 g carbohydrate, trace fiber, trace protein.
